Lima: Magic Water Circuit Light Show Tour with Pickup

1.Magic Water Circuit Light Show Tour with Pickup

★★★★★★★★★★4.9 · 251 reviews · from $38Our pick

Ride from Miraflores, Barranco, or San Isidro to Lima’s Magic Water Circuit for a guided evening walk through its fountains. Guides such as Pamela, Mabel, and César explain the park and Peru’s past before the Fantasy Fountain show. Transport, admission, and return hotel drop-off are included.

Magic Water & Laser Light Show Including Pickup And Drop-Off

3.Magic Water & Laser Light Show Including Pickup And Drop-Off

★★★★★★★★★★5.0 · 76 reviews · 2 hours 30 minutes (approx.) · from $35

Visit Lima’s Magic Water Circuit with a professional guide, air-conditioned transport, and admission included. Walk among 13 illuminated fountains, learn about Peruvian culture, and watch the main laser and water show. Guides such as JJ, Mauricio, Paola, and Maverick help you handle the crowds and find good viewing spots.

Lima in a Day: City Sightseeing Tour, Larco Museum and Magic Water Circuit

5.Lima in a Day: City Sightseeing Tour, Larco Museum and Magic Water Circuit

★★★★★★★★★★4.5 · 63 reviews · 11 hours (approx.) · from $257

This 11-hour Lima tour combines Miraflores, Huaca Pucllana, Plaza Mayor, the Cathedral, Santo Domingo Convent, Larco Museum, a seaside buffet, pisco sour, and the Magic Water Circuit. A bilingual guide, hotel transport, lunch, and snacks are included. Guides may include Ursula, Gabriella, or Victor.
